Hébergement: Lisbonne regorge d'hôtels et de villas de luxe, parfaitement adaptés à votre quête d'élégance et de tranquillité. Le Four Seasons Hotel Ritz Lisbon, par exemple, offre un service impeccable et une situation idéale. Pour une expérience plus intime, de splendides villas avec piscine, situées dans les quartiers chics comme Alcântara ou Cascais, sont disponibles à la location. Attendez-vous à un budget allant de 500€ à 2000€ par nuit, selon votre choix.
Gastronomie: Préparez vos papilles à une explosion de saveurs ! Les restaurants lisboètes vous proposeront des délices locaux et des interprétations modernes de la cuisine portugaise. Comptez environ 100€ par personne et par repas dans les établissements haut de gamme. N'oubliez pas de savourer les fameuses Pastéis de Belém, ces petits flans à la crème pâtissière, un incontournable de votre voyage gourmand.

Lisbon in winter offers a unique ambiance. The crisp air carries the scent of the Atlantic, while the sun, though less intense, still warms the charming, historic streets. Expect temperatures averaging between 8-15°C (46-59°F), perfect for exploring without the summer heat. The city's architectural style, a mix of Moorish, Baroque and Pombaline, creates a breathtaking backdrop for your culinary journey. You'll see beautiful examples of azulejos (hand-painted tiles) adorning buildings, adding splashes of color to the often grey winter skies.
Our culinary exploration begins with Michelin-starred restaurants. Lisbon boasts several, each offering a unique experience. Consider Belcanto, renowned for its innovative tasting menus showcasing Portuguese ingredients. Expect to pay around €250-€350 per person, excluding drinks. Alternatively, Alma, another Michelin-starred gem, provides a more classic Portuguese experience, with a similar price range. Transportation to and from these establishments can be easily managed via taxi (€15-€25 each way) or ride-sharing services.
For a more intimate experience, let's arrange a private chef to prepare a delectable meal within your luxurious accommodation. This personalized service, costing approximately €500-€800 for four people, allows you to savor authentic Portuguese flavors in the comfort of your chosen setting. Imagine indulging in Bacalhau à Brás (shredded cod with potatoes and eggs) or Arroz de Marisco (seafood rice), accompanied by a fine Portuguese wine.

Our Lisbon adventure begins with a private transfer from the airport to your luxurious hotel, the Memmo Alfama, known for its stunning views and eco-conscious practices. (Transfer cost: €100). After settling in, we'll embark on a private walking tour of Alfama, Lisbon’s oldest district, exploring its labyrinthine streets and discovering hidden gems. This includes a private tasting of traditional Portuguese wines paired with local cheeses and olives at a family-run Adega (wine cellar). (Private tour & tasting: €400)
Day two is dedicated to art and culture. We’ll enjoy a private guided tour of the Museu Calouste Gulbenkian, renowned for its impressive collection of art from around the world, followed by a private viewing of a Fado performance at a historic venue – an intimate experience that truly captures the soul of Lisbon. (Museum & Fado tickets: €300). Dinner will be at a Michelin-starred restaurant, showcasing the freshest seasonal ingredients in modern Portuguese cuisine. (Dinner: €500)
On day three, we’ll venture beyond the city limits. A private day trip to Sintra, a UNESCO World Heritage site, awaits. We’ll explore the fairytale Pena Palace, the Quinta da Regaleira, and the mystical Moorish Castle, all with private transportation and a knowledgeable guide offering insights into the region's history and legends. (Sintra excursion: €800 including transportation and lunch).
Our culinary journey continues with a hands-on pastéis de nata baking class, followed by a delightful lunch featuring this iconic Portuguese treat and other local delicacies. (Baking class and lunch: €200).
